Summary of the comparison

Elston Hall Primary School and St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y are primary schools in Wolverhampton.

  • Elston Hall Primary School scores 67 out of 100 (grade C, average) and St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y scores 78 out of 100 (grade B, strong). St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y is ahead on our composite score.

  • Elston Hall Primary School was judged strong and St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y was judged Good.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 71.0% for Elston Hall Primary School and 80.0% for St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has held broadly level at Elston Hall Primary School (71.0% in 2022-23, 71.0% in 2024-25) and has held broadly level at St Anthony's Catholic Primary Academy (81.0% in 2022-23, 80.0% in 2024-25).
